Study on iron-based diamond bit by DC-electroplating method

Iron-plating technology used for restoration of axis parts was applied to the manufacture of diamond bits in this paper. The technology for electroplating diamond bit of iron matrix was mastered through repeated experiments and research. The productive practice indicated that the DC-electroplated iron matrix of diamond bit has high hardness and good diamond exposure ability;the drilling rate of electroplated iron-based diamond bit was 2 m/h when drilling in grade 9 granite and bit life can reach 44 m, which can satisfy the drilling production requirements.
